Start a Cake Franchise in NYC: Investment and Requirements
Understanding the financial landscape is essential for anyone considering a bakery franchise NY investment. While costs vary by brand, location, and concept type, several general parameters apply across the industry.
Initial Investment Range
The total investment required to launch a cake store franchise NYC typically falls within these ranges:
- Small Format (500-800 sq ft): $150,000 – $300,000
- Medium Format (800-1,200 sq ft): $250,000 – $450,000
- Large Format (1,200+ sq ft): $400,000 – $750,000+
This investment typically covers:
- Franchise fee: The upfront payment for joining the franchise system
- Leasehold improvements: Customizing the retail space to brand specifications
- Equipment: Specialized baking equipment, display cases, and kitchen infrastructure
- Initial inventory: Starting supply of ingredients and packaging
- Marketing: Grand opening campaigns and initial promotional activities
- Training: Staff and management preparation
- Working capital: Funds to cover operations until profitability is achieved
Franchise Fee Structures
Most cake shop franchise NYC opportunities require an initial franchise fee, typically ranging from $25,000 to $50,000, which grants the right to operate under the brand and access training and systems. Ongoing royalty fees generally range from 4-8% of gross sales, with additional marketing fees of 1-3%.
Financial Requirements for Approval
Franchise brands typically assess candidates based on these financial metrics:
- Net worth: Most franchisors require a minimum net worth of $250,000-$500,000
- Liquid capital: Typically $75,000-$150,000 in immediately available funds
- Credit score: Generally 680+ for favorable financing options
- Debt-to-income ratio: Usually below 45% for approval
Financing Options
Several pathways exist to fund a dessert bar franchise NY investment:
- SBA loans: 7(a) loans offer favorable terms for franchise investments
- Franchisor financing: Some brands provide direct financing or arrangements with preferred lenders
- Commercial bank loans: Traditional business financing for qualified borrowers
- Investors/partners: Equity sharing arrangements with financial partners
- 401(k)/IRA rollover: Utilizing retirement funds without penalties through proper business structures

Financial Projections: Understanding Bakery Franchise Economics
Realistic financial projections are essential when evaluating cake shop franchise NYC opportunities.
Revenue Potential
Typical annual revenue ranges for established cake shop franchises in NYC:
- Small Format: $350,000 – $700,000
- Medium Format: $600,000 – $1,200,000
- Large Format/Café Hybrid: $900,000 – $1,800,000+
Key revenue drivers include:
- Special occasion cakes: Often the highest margin products
- Everyday dessert purchases: Regular customer visits for individual servings
- Corporate and event orders: High-volume B2B sales opportunities
- Complementary items: Coffee, beverages, and savory options when applicable
Profit Margin Considerations
Industry benchmarks for sweet bakery NYC operations:
- Cost of goods sold: Typically 28-35% for bakery items
- Labor costs: Generally 25-30% of revenue
- Occupancy costs: 10-15% in NYC (higher than national averages)
- Marketing: 3-5% of gross sales
- Royalties/fees: 5-9% for most franchise systems
- Typical net profit: 8-15% for well-managed operations
Break-Even Analysis
Most cake store franchise NYC operations achieve monthly break-even within:
- Best case: 6-9 months
- Average case: 12-15 months
- Conservative case: 18-24 months
Critical factors affecting break-even timing:
- Location quality: Prime locations typically reach profitability faster
- Opening execution: Strong grand openings accelerate customer awareness
- Operational efficiency: Proper inventory and labor management
- Marketing effectiveness: Success of local store marketing initiatives
Long-Term Returns
For well-operated cake shop franchise NYC businesses:
- Investment recoupment: Typically 3-5 years for single units
- Second/third unit efficiency: Improved returns through operational synergies
- Exit strategy value: Established units often sell for 2.5-3.5x annual profit

How long does it take to open a bakery franchise after signing an agreement?
The timeline from signing a franchise agreement to opening a cake shop in NYC typically ranges from 6-12 months. This process includes site selection (1-3 months), lease negotiation (1-2 months), architectural plans and permits (2-3 months in NYC due to Department of Buildings processes), build-out (2-3 months), equipment installation (2-4 weeks), staff hiring and training (1 month), and pre-opening preparations (2 weeks). The NYC permitting process often takes longer than in other markets, which should be factored into timeline expectations.
